สารบัญ:
วีดีโอ: การมิเรอร์มีอยู่ใน SQL 2016 หรือไม่
2024 ผู้เขียน: Lynn Donovan | [email protected]. แก้ไขล่าสุด: 2023-12-15 23:54
ณ เดือนกุมภาพันธ์ 2016 , Microsoft ระบุว่า: “[ฐานข้อมูล มิเรอร์ ] จะถูกลบออกใน Microsoft. เวอร์ชันอนาคต SQL Server . หลีกเลี่ยงการใช้คุณลักษณะนี้ในงานพัฒนาใหม่ และวางแผนที่จะแก้ไขแอปพลิเคชันที่ใช้คุณลักษณะนี้ในปัจจุบัน ใช้ AlwaysOn Availability Groups แทน”
ดังนั้นการมิเรอร์ฐานข้อมูลใน SQL Server 2016 คืออะไร
การมิเรอร์ฐานข้อมูล ใช้ในการเคลื่อนย้าย ฐานข้อมูล การทำธุรกรรมจากหนึ่ง ฐานข้อมูล SQL Server (อาจารย์ใหญ่ ฐานข้อมูล ) ไปอีก ฐานข้อมูล SQL Server (กระจก ฐานข้อมูล ) ในกรณีอื่น ใน SQL Server บันทึกการจัดส่งและ มิเรอร์ สามารถทำงานร่วมกันเพื่อจัดหาโซลูชั่นสำหรับความพร้อมใช้งานสูงและการกู้คืนจากภัยพิบัติ
ต่อมา คำถามคือ ข้อกำหนดเบื้องต้นสำหรับการมิเรอร์ฐานข้อมูลมีอะไรบ้าง ข้อกำหนดเบื้องต้น
- สำหรับการสร้างเซสชันการมิเรอร์ คู่ค้าและพยาน (ถ้ามี) จะต้องทำงานบน SQL Server เวอร์ชันเดียวกัน
- คู่ค้าทั้งสองซึ่งเป็นเซิร์ฟเวอร์หลักและเซิร์ฟเวอร์มิเรอร์ ต้องใช้งาน SQL Server รุ่นเดียวกัน
- ฐานข้อมูลต้องใช้รูปแบบการกู้คืนแบบเต็ม
ในที่นี้ การมิเรอร์ใน SQL คืออะไร?
SQL ฐานข้อมูลเซิร์ฟเวอร์ มิเรอร์ เป็นการกู้คืนจากภัยพิบัติและเทคนิคความพร้อมใช้งานสูงที่เกี่ยวข้องกับสอง SQL อินสแตนซ์เซิร์ฟเวอร์บนเครื่องเดียวกันหรือต่างกัน หนึ่ง SQL อินสแตนซ์ของเซิร์ฟเวอร์ทำหน้าที่เป็นอินสแตนซ์หลักที่เรียกว่าหลักการ ในขณะที่อีกอินสแตนซ์คือ a มิเรอร์ ตัวอย่างที่เรียกว่า กระจก.
ฉันจะตรวจสอบการมิเรอร์ฐานข้อมูลได้อย่างไร
การตรวจสอบมิเรอร์ฐานข้อมูล
- เปิด Management Studio และเชื่อมต่อกับเซิร์ฟเวอร์หลักหรือเซิร์ฟเวอร์มิเรอร์
- ขยายฐานข้อมูลและคลิกขวาที่ฐานข้อมูลหลัก
- เลือก งาน แล้วคลิก เปิดใช้ Database Mirroring Monitor
- คลิกเมนูการดำเนินการ และเลือกลงทะเบียนฐานข้อมูลมิเรอร์
แนะนำ:
นับ Null ใน SQL หรือไม่
ค่า NULL ใน SQL หมายความว่าไม่มีค่าสำหรับฟิลด์ การเปรียบเทียบค่า NULL ไม่สามารถทำได้ด้วย “=” หรือ “!= การใช้ SELECT COUNT(*) หรือ SELECT COUNT(1) (ซึ่งเป็นสิ่งที่ฉันชอบใช้) จะส่งคืนผลรวมของเรคคอร์ดทั้งหมดที่ส่งคืนในชุดผลลัพธ์โดยไม่คำนึงถึง ค่า NULL
ตารางล็อคการอัปเดต SQL หรือไม่
โดยทั่วไปไม่ แต่ขึ้นอยู่กับ (คำตอบที่ใช้บ่อยที่สุดสำหรับ SQL Server!) SQL Server จะต้องล็อคข้อมูลที่เกี่ยวข้องกับธุรกรรมในทางใดทางหนึ่ง ต้องล็อคข้อมูลในตารางและข้อมูลดัชนีที่ได้รับผลกระทบในขณะที่คุณทำการแก้ไข
TFS รวมสิทธิ์การใช้งาน SQL Server หรือไม่
ผู้พัฒนา: Microsoft Corporation
SQL เหมือนกับ SQL Server หรือไม่?
คำตอบ: ความแตกต่างที่สำคัญระหว่าง SQL และ MSSQL คือ SQL เป็นภาษาคิวรีที่ใช้ฐานข้อมูลแบบสัมพันธ์กัน ในขณะที่ MS SQL Server เป็นระบบจัดการฐานข้อมูลเชิงเปรียบเทียบ (RDBMS) ที่พัฒนาโดย Microsoft RDBMS เชิงพาณิชย์ส่วนใหญ่ใช้ SQL เพื่อโต้ตอบกับฐานข้อมูล
Hyper V ฟรีกับ Windows 2016 หรือไม่
แพลตฟอร์ม Microsoft Hyper-V 2016 เป็นเวอร์ชันฟรีของไฮเปอร์ไวเซอร์ที่ Microsoft นำเสนอ Hyper-V 2016 เวอร์ชันฟรีเหมาะสำหรับกรณีใดบ้าง ข้อแม้ประการหนึ่งสำหรับแพลตฟอร์ม Hyper-V 2016 คือคุณไม่ได้รับสิทธิ์ใช้งานสำหรับแขกของ Windows ที่มาพร้อมกับผลิตภัณฑ์เนื่องจากเป็นบริการฟรี